The 10kV-70kN Tongue-Clevis Insulator is engineered to support medium-voltage overhead power lines, combining high electrical insulation with superior mechanical performance. This insulator is built to handle a voltage of 10kV and a mechanical load of up to 70kN, providing secure line support while minimizing the risk of failure in demanding conditions.
Key Features:
- Voltage Rating (10kV): Specifically designed for low-to-medium voltage systems, offering excellent protection against electrical faults and arcing.
- Mechanical Load Capacity (70kN): With a load-bearing capacity of 70kN, this insulator provides strong support, making it ideal for lines under moderate tension or in areas with challenging environmental conditions.
- Tongue-Clevis Design: The tongue-clevis connection provides a stable, secure attachment to power lines and poles while allowing for flexibility, reducing mechanical stress and enhancing long-term durability.
- Weather Resistance: Made with high-quality porcelain or polymer composite materials, the insulator is resistant to environmental factors such as UV exposure, moisture, and corrosion, ensuring prolonged operational life.
- Corrosion and UV Resistance: The durable materials resist degradation caused by weathering, ensuring the insulator performs reliably for years.
- Quick and Easy Installation: The design simplifies the installation process, saving time and reducing maintenance costs.
Applications:
The 10kV-70kN Tongue-Clevis Insulator is suitable for use in medium-voltage distribution lines, such as:
- Overhead transmission systems in urban and rural environments.
- Power grids in areas with moderate mechanical stress and typical weather conditions.
- Substations and electrical networks that require secure line support with high mechanical load handling.
